Description
The Cross Wanderlust Everest Ballpoint Pen is a striking luxury writing instrument inspired by the dramatic beauty of Mount Everest. Part of the Wanderlust collection from Cross, it combines an artistic, nature-inspired pattern with refined metallic detailing and modern black PVD appointments. The pen features an Everest-inspired design layered over a white lacquer body, accented with chrome-plated engravings and black PVD trim. Its rich, swirling pattern gives each angle of the pen a distinctive, sophisticated appearance. A curved clip adds to its elegant profile. Its swivel-action mechanism provides smooth propel-and-repel operation, while the supplied black medium ballpoint refill (#8513) delivers reliable everyday writing. The pen is presented in a premium Cross gift box and is covered by Cross's lifetime mechanical warranty.
Cross Company, LLC. is an American manufacturing company of writing implements, based in Providence, Rhode Island. Founded in 1846, it is one of the oldest pen manufacturers in the world. Cross' products include fountain, ballpoint, and rollerball pens, mechanical pencils and refills. The first Cross Fountain Pen debuted in 1846. It was called Peerless in tribute to its unmatched technology and design. Modern day Cross fountain pens follow in that matchless mould and continue to set the standard for modern writing instruments to this day.
